#419527 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#419527 is composed of 25.5% red, 58.4% green and 15.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 73.8%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 105.8 degrees, a saturation of 58.5% and a lightness of 36.9%. #419527 color hex could be obtained by blending #82ff4e with #002b00.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

Shades and Tints of #419527
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040902 is the darkest color, while #fafdf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#419527
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5c625a is the less saturated color, while #2eb903 is the most saturated one.
